Types of Door Glass
Before starting a repair upvc Door job, it is important for house owners to understand the different kinds of door glass.
Kind Of Door GlassDescriptionSingle PaneComposed of one layer of glass, single-pane doors are the most basic and affordable choice but use less insulation.Double PaneIncluding two layers of glass separated by an insulating space, double-pane doors are more energy-efficient and assist regulate indoor temperature level.Tempered GlassThis type of glass is treated with heat to increase its strength and safety. It shatters into small, less harmful pieces when broken.Laminated GlassLaminated glass consists of 2 layers of glass with a plastic interlayer that holds the pieces together if broken, using boosted security and sound insulation.Frosted GlassThis glass is treated to develop a translucent look, allowing light in while keeping personal privacy. It can be single or double-pane.
Comprehending the type of glass used in your door can affect your approach to repair or replacement.
Typical Door Glass Issues
A number of typical concerns might emerge with door glass, necessitating repair.
Fractures and Chips: Minor damage can often be repaired if it does not compromise the structural integrity of the glass.Broken Glass: Complete shattering or large breaks will generally require replacement.Seal Failure: In double-pane doors, a broken seal can result in moisture build-up in between the panes, leading to fogging or condensation.Scratches: Surface scratches can often be polished out however may require expert treatment for deeper scratches.Actions for Repairing Door Glass1. Examine the Damage
Before any repair begins, examine the degree of the damage. If the damage is substantial (e.g., shattered glass), it may be best to replace the entire panel. For small cracks or chips, repairs can often be made with the ideal products.
2. Collect Required Tools and Materials
To efficiently repair door glass, property owners will need the following tools:
Safety safety glasses and glovesEnergy knifeGlass cleaner Glass adhesive (for small cracks)Replacement glass panel (for extensive damage)Putty knifeCaulk gun and silicone sealant (if needed)3. Remove Old Glass (if relevant)
If changing the glass, carefully remove the damaged panel. Use an utility knife to cut through any caulking or seals. Lift the shattered glass out thoroughly to avoid injury.
4. Tidy the Frame
When the old glass is removed, tidy the frame thoroughly to make sure a tight seal for the brand-new glass. Use glass cleaner and a putty knife to get rid of any particles.
5. Set Up New Glass or Repair Existing Damage
For little chips or cracks, use glass adhesive and press the edges together. For total replacements, follow these steps:
Cut the new glass panel to size (if needed).Use a bead of silicone sealant around the frame.Position the glass panel in the frame, pressing it strongly into the sealant.6. Seal and Secure
When the brand-new glass is placed, guarantee it is effectively sealed. Extra caulking may be applied around the edges for included support. Permit adequate drying time as specified by the adhesive or sealant producer.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Can I repair door glass myself?
Yes, small damage can typically be repaired by property owners. Nevertheless, for substantial damage or if handling dangerous materials, working with a professional is suggested.
2. How do I understand if my double-pane glass requires replacement?
If you see condensation between the panes or fogging that does not clear, the seal might be broken, and professional replacement is often essential.
3. What kind of adhesive should I utilize for glass repair?
Use a professional-grade glass adhesive for repairing chips. For bigger replacements, silicone sealant is ideal for sealing the edges.
4. Is it worth repairing minor fractures?
Yes, repairing small cracks can extend the life of the door glass and prevent further damage while saving money on replacement expenses.
5. What should I do if the glass is shattered?
If the glass is shattered, it is best to replace the panel completely due to safety concerns and the potential for injury from rugged edges.
